That's a bit awkward!


The other night I sat up with my parents to watch the premiere of Channel 10's new series 'Trippin Over.' At the end of the episode, there was quite a raunchy sex scene which would make anyone blush - especially when your parents were sitting right next to you.

I know we're all adults here but watching sex scenes with your parents is probably one of the most awkward situations you will ever experience. For me, I feel like I am doing something really wrong and dirty, feeling that my parents think less of me for watching such filth! But hey, I bet they saw worse in their day!


Another occasion I was watching Sex and the City - the episode where the girls go to a day spa and everyone is walking around naked. My Dad so happened to walk through the lounge room when I was watching it and I have never seen someone's eyes pop out of their head as his did. He questioned what I was watching and then sat down and continued to watch the naked girls walking around. He had such a smile on his face, I felt repulsed. As if I wanted to see my Dad get his rocks off watching my favorite show.

I don't know whether there should be a ban on watching shows of a sexual nature with your parents - yes, a stupid idea but how do you recover from such an embarrassing situation?

Have you ever had to sit through a raunchy show or move with your folks? If so, how did you deal with the awkwardness?

Dating Outrage!


A Current Affair featured a story this week that completely outraged not only the dating community but the entire Australian society.

It involved a dating site called ‘Beautiful People’ – check it out at http://au.beautifulpeople.net

As they describe themselves they are ‘an online community whose purpose is to create relationships, both private and professional, between people who because of their attractive appearance and personal qualities stand out from the majority.’ In laymen’s terms it is a dating site for ONLY beautiful people!

But who decides if you’re beautiful or not? Basically to apply to this dating site, you have to submit of photo of yourself. Over a 72 hour period the members of the site vote on whether you are good looking enough to be part of the site. If not, you’re basically branded ugly and not allowed to meet fellow daters.

What sort of message is this sending to people – if you’re ugly don’t bother applying? It’s as shallow as Posh Spice!

It’s also bullying - it’s like being back in the school yard and if you don’t make the cut, you get a mocking!!!

Dating is suppose to be about having fun and MOST dating sites provide this but what on earth does Beautiful People provide – bullying, mockery, discrimination, shallowness?

Considering 60,000 people in the world are connected to this website perhaps we are turning into shallow and vein people only wanting to meet and date those of our own standards?

But aren’t we all beautiful in our own way?
